  • Patent number: 10150483
    Abstract: A method and system for managing settings on a single vehicle/implement system and across a fleet of vehicle/implement systems. Each vehicle/implement system includes a plurality of Embedded Systems having configurable settings, a Precision Agriculture Server having configurable settings, and a Telematics Server having configurable settings. All of the servers are connected by a plurality of vehicle data busses. The Telematics Server is connected to Cloud-Based Servers via the Internet. Vehicle/implement system settings are managed by the Precision Ag Server and shared with other vehicle/implement systems via the Cloud-based Server. Flexibility for different vehicle/implement models and options is provided by a distributed system using Client Software in the Precision Ag Server or Client Software in the Embedded Systems and by a settings identification and versioning schema.

  • Patent number: 9119348
    Abstract: An implement is coupled to and pulled by a tractor. The tractor includes ground engaging drive wheels driven by an engine, an operator movable speed command device, and a tractor controller having automatic and manual speed control modes. The implement has an implement control unit coupled to the tractor controller. The implement control unit transmits an implement speed request signal to the tractor controller. The tractor controller controls tractor motion in response to operation of the speed command device and the implement speed request signal.

  • Patent number: 9089095
    Abstract: A tractor includes an electronic tractor controller. A baler includes an electronic baler controller. The baler controller submits a halt signal to the tractor controller when a bale size is equal to or exceeds a first predetermined size. The baler controller generates a tractor halt signal in response to certain conditions of the baler system and the tractor controller preventing tractor motion in response to the halt signal. When the baler controller is generating the halt signal, tractor motion is enabled if the operator commands the tractor to move by manipulating the command device, and within a certain time period of said command being issued, the baler controller generates a tractor motion enabling signal in response a status of the baler system. When the baler controller is generating the halt signal, tractor motion is enabled if the operator moves the tractor command device in a special manner.

  • Patent number: 8527156
    Abstract: A tractor comprises a tractor frame, driven ground engaging means, and an electronic tractor controller. A baler comprises a baler frame coupled or connected to the tractor frame, a crop receiving means, a baling chamber, a bale size sensor associated with the baling chamber, and an electronic baler controller. The baler controller is operable to submit a halt signal to the tractor controller when a bale size signal provided by the bale size sensor indicates that a bale has reached a size equal to or exceeding a first predetermined size. A control method includes the baler controller generating a tractor halt signal in response to certain conditions of the baler system and the tractor controller preventing tractor motion in response to the halt signal.
